Torrita di Siena 82km: Gravel Trek Through Charming Tuscan Villages.


A gravel cycling route starting from Torrita di Siena

Embark on an 82km gravel trek that takes you through captivating Tuscan villages and peaceful countryside.

Map

Discover the charm of the Tuscan countryside and its charming villages with this 82km gravel cycling route starting near Torrita di Siena. This medium-difficulty route is perfect for experienced amateur cyclists, with a total ascent of 1396m. Along the way, riders will have the opportunity to visit some of Toscana's most picturesque destinations, such as Asciano, Poggiodarno, and Modanella. These traditional Tuscan villages offer a glimpse into the region's rich history and cultural heritage. Poggio l'Aiole, with its scenic beauty, is another highlight along the route, providing bre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. The overall epicness of this route is rated 3 out of 5, offering a rewarding and enjoyable experience for cyclists.

Start: Torrita di Siena Village center
Torrita di Siena: Conquering the legendary Monte Amiata and immersed in stunning Tuscan landscapes.
Torrita di Siena, situated in the Toscana region of Italy, is a haven for road and gravel cyclists. The locality is surrounded by beautiful rolling hills, offering challenging routes for cyclists of all levels. The region is famous for its vineyards and olive groves, providing cyclists with stunning scenery to enjoy during their rides. Torrita di Siena is also close to the iconic Monte Amiata, a legendary climb known for its breathtaking views and steep gradients. Cyclists visiting Torrita di Siena can also explore nearby towns such as Montisi and Pienza, known for their cycling-friendly atmosphere.
